Transaction 2783d07a3ee1953e9521edaa6824c1c498dfa03e7026eff2ab29e68e20f1ac77

block
7521cbdc3a1bbee8d22fd0f35a16c153bb134dc5cc47591b26fbe1d772443039

53 Inputs

1 Output